Historical Events on June 23

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on June 23rd.

YearEvent
1713The French residents of Acadia are given one year to declare allegiance to Britain or leave Nova Scotia, Canada.
1757Battle of Plassey: Three thousand British troops under Robert Clive defeat a 50,000-strong Indian army under Siraj ud-Daulah at Plassey.
1758Seven Years' War: Battle of Krefeld: British, Hanoverian, and Prussian forces defeat French troops at Krefeld in Germany.
1760Seven Years' War: Battle of Landeshut: Austria defeats Prussia.
1780American Revolution: Battle of Springfield fought in and around Springfield, New Jersey (including Short Hills, formerly of Springfield, now of Millburn Township).
1794Empress Catherine II of Russia grants Jews permission to settle in Kyiv.
1810John Jacob Astor forms the Pacific Fur Company.
1812War of 1812: Great Britain revokes the restrictions on American commerce, thus eliminating one of the chief reasons for going to war.
1860The United States Congress establishes the Government Printing Office.
1865American Civil War: At Fort Towson in the Oklahoma Territory, Confederate Brigadier General Stand Watie surrenders the last significant Confederate army.

Popular Baby Name on June 23, 1945

In 1945,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, James is the most used. A total of 74,460 baby boys were named James in 1945. The rest were named Robert, John, William and Richard. While the popular baby girl name in 1945 was Mary. There were 59,281 baby girls named Mary that year. While the rest were named Linda, Barbara, Patricia and Carol.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
